Looking to join an Outstanding Design & Technology department in Birmingham?
A high-performing secondary school with an Ofsted Outstanding rating is seeking an innovative, skilled, and dedicated Design & Technology Teacher to join its successful academic community.

Job Overview

Our client is recruiting for a Design & Technology Teacher to begin ASAP or April 2026 . This Outstanding school is renowned for:

  • Its consistently high academic standards

  • Exceptional behaviour and attitudes to learning

  • A strong commitment to creativity, innovation, and practical learning

The successful candidate will deliver engaging and intellectually ambitious DT lessons from KS3 to KS5 , working with motivated pupils who take pride in their work and demonstrate strong ambition across the curriculum.

The School

Design & Technology plays a central role within the school’s curriculum and enrichment offer. The department is exceptionally well-resourced, featuring modern workshops, specialist equipment, and strong technical support.

Pupils benefit from:

  • A broad and ambitious Design & Technology curriculum

  • Exposure to resistant materials, product design, and CAD/CAM

  • Opportunities for practical design, prototyping, testing, and evaluation

  • A strong emphasis on creativity, independent thinking, and problem-solving

Parents consistently praise the school’s strong leadership, calm learning environment, and excellent outcomes. Staff highlight the collaborative culture, clear systems, and strong professional development opportunities available.

Benefits typically include:

  • Outstanding CPD and leadership development pathways

  • Modern facilities and excellent technical support

  • A genuine focus on staff wellbeing

  • A supportive and respectful working environment

Location: Birmingham
Start Date: ASAP or April 2026
Salary: MPS/UPS (dependent on experience)

DT Teacher – Experience and Qualifications

  • A degree in Design & Technology or a related discipline

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S)

  • Strong subject knowledge and practical expertise

  • Excellent classroom management and organisational skills

  • The ability to inspire and challenge pupils of all abilities

  • The legal right to work in the UK
